South Devon: Plymouth to Dartmouth

This was one of the odder sections of the path that we walked. After getting hopelessly lost in Plymouth at the end of our last stage, and failing to connect with the southern end of the Two Moors Way through a simple inability to judge distances on a map, we set out with a powerful air of caution. Parts of this stage are fascinating to visit and as pretty as a picture but others are drab, difficult and ugly. The river valleys also pose an incredible challenge since you need a supernatural degree of organisation to co-ordinate all the tidal ferries and arrive at each during its hours of operation. And then there’s the wading…
